The impact of CCR5-Δ32 deletion on C-reactive protein levels and cardiovascular disease: Results from the Danish Blood Donor Study.
Atherosclerosis - 1 Sept 2015
Dinh Khoa M, Pedersen Ole B, Petersen Mikkel S, Sørensen Erik, Sørensen Cecilie J, Kaspersen Kathrine A, Larsen Margit H, Møller Bjarne, Hjalgrim Henrik, Ullum Henrik, Erikstrup Christian
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ND AND PURPOSE: The C-C chemokine receptor 5-Δ32 deletion (CCR5-Δ32) has been associated with lower levels of C-reactive protein (CRP), but the effect on cardiovascular diseases is uncertain. This study addresses the impact of CCR5-Δ32 on the risk of low-grade inflammation and hospitalization with cardiovascular diseases in a large cohort of blood donors.
